Ercole Barovier (1889-1974)

At the age of 26, he becomes the artistic director of his father’s factory, « Vetreria Artistica Barovier et C ». He becomes a partner of the company four years later. In 1936, Ercole became sole owner of the enterprise and decided to merge it with another famous factory: S.A.I.A.R. Ferro Toso. In 1942, « Vetreria Artistica Barovier et C » was renamed « Barovier et Toso ».Ercole remained artistic director during 30 years, until 1972. Throughout his career, he kept inventing new techniques and colour combinations. Barovier’s contribution to the revival of glass art is essential.
